Zelensky Seeks Long-Term Security Guarantees Amid Evolving U.S. Relations

TL;DR Summary
U.S. President Trump and Ukrainian President Zelenskyy are close to reaching an agreement to end the Ukraine war, with progress on security guarantees and ongoing negotiations on key issues like Donbas, while European leaders emphasize the importance of security assurances for Ukraine. Meanwhile, Russia continues military strikes in Ukraine, causing casualties.
